Pierce County clean sweep coming up By Phil Pfuehler, RiverTown Staff Pierce County residents can get rid of their hazardous materials from 8 a.m. to noon Saturday, April 19, at the county's Materials Recovery Facility on Hwy. 65 just north of Ellsworth. This free disposal day is held annually and called Spring Clean Sweep. For the first time, unwanted medications will be added to the list of discarded items. That list includes: Pesticides, fertilizers, solvents, fuels, cleaning agents; also lead, oil, aerosol and latex-based and aerosol paints; plus other chemicals from farms, homes and businesses. "We have been encouraging farmers, residents and business people to look through their barns, sheds, garages, basements, storage cabinets, and under the kitchen and bathroom sinks for any and all unwanted chemicals and paints," said Steve Melstrom, Pierce County Solid Waste coordinator. "Now we're asking them to look in their medicine cabinets, too, for all unwanted medications." Discarded materials should be kept in their original containers so they can be properly identified and disposed of. For more information, call the Pierce County Solid Waste office at 273-3092.
